Hi Maren,

Handing off the open item on ReportForge's report builder. The security concern is that the unstable sort in the export path can reorder redacted rows relative to their audit annotations, which a reviewer flagged as a possible information-leak vector. I've pinned the export engine to the stable comparator behind the `safe_sort` flag in staging; production is unchanged pending your sign-off. Test fixtures and the diff are in the review bundle. Questions on the flag rollout can go to the export platform team.

escalation mailbox, bafog-fafog: ulador@paliqlabs.internal

Visitor policy, Thornevale Campus: when Aldbury Estates conducts its quarterly site audit, auditors must sign in at the main desk, wear a red lanyard at all times, and remain escorted in all non-public areas. New starters should not admit auditors themselves; direct them to the duty manager. Escorts entering plant rooms with auditors must first enter the following.

door code, bagef-yafop: bdg-ZFZML-07646

Finance Review Summary — Customer Concentration, Verelux Group

Revenue concentration remains elevated: the Dunmoor account represents 31% of recurring income, up from 26% last year. Two further accounts together add 18%. Contract renewal timing clusters in the second quarter, compounding exposure. Heads of department should factor this into hiring and inventory commitments. Mitigation options are under review, and the confidential note below sets out the plan.

internal memo for faweg-hahip: Silokix Works plans to lower the Tamvan list price by 8 percent in June.

Minutes — Management Meeting, Warranty-Cost Overrun

Present: the executive committee of Drayfell Appliances. Finance reported warranty claims on the Lindqvist oven range exceeded forecast by 41%, driven by a faulty thermostat batch from supplier Obranek. Remediation: supplier recharge negotiations, extended inspection at the Vastermoor plant, revised accrual methodology. The board requested monthly tracking until claims normalise. Discussion then turned to strategic implications, summarised confidentially below.

confidential, hadup-yaguf: Briielox Systems plans to raise the Holax list price by 5 percent in July.